Webs of Fate

Webs of Fate is a Dark and Darker quest assigned by the Alchemist merchant, part of the Dark Omens quest line. When you visited the castle... Did you see them? Spiders are everywhere. I heard some rooms are so bad, you can’t walk without them biting at your ankles. They crawl out from those wretched pots that have been sitting in the castle untouched for years! If you destroy enough of those pots, it might send those spiders back into hiding for good. The objective is to interact with spider pot ×3. All progress requires a successful extraction — items retrieved or kills made during a failed run do not count toward quest completion. Once every objective is fulfilled, return to Alchemist in the lobby to turn in the quest and receive the reward. This quest requires completing Lights Out before it becomes available from Alchemist. Completing Webs of Fate rewards 75 Gold, Random Uncommon Armor, 125 XP. The quest is completed in Crypts.
